- Apr 30, 2022 · 3 years agoAUM stands for Assets Under Management, which refers to the total value of assets that a financial institution manages on behalf of its clients. In the context of cryptocurrency investments, AUM represents the total value of cryptocurrencies held by a fund or investment firm. A higher AUM indicates a larger pool of funds being managed, which can potentially attract more investors and provide greater market influence. It is an important metric for evaluating the size and success of a cryptocurrency investment firm.
